Choosing the Perfect Green Bell Pepper Plants for Sale

When it comes to selecting the right green bell pepper plants, we understand that the sheer number of options can be overwhelming. We have meticulously researched and compiled a list of considerations that will help you make an informed decision. The starting point for a highyield garden is always the quality of the plants themselves. We recommend looking for plants that are vibrant green, with a sturdy stem and no signs of wilting or discoloration. The leaves should be full and healthy, and we strongly advise checking the underside for any evidence of pests, such as aphids or spider mites. We prefer plants that are compact and bushy, as this indicates a strong root system and a promising future.

We find that the best plants often come from reputable nurseries and online suppliers who specialize in vegetable seedlings. We have observed that these sources pay close attention to the genetic quality of their plants, offering robust, diseaseresistant varieties. When you are browsing for "green bell pepper plants for sale," we suggest that you pay attention to the specific variety names. Some varieties are known for their exceptional sweetness, while others are prized for their thick walls, making them ideal for stuffing. We have found that varieties like 'California Wonder,' 'Jupiter,' and 'King Arthur' consistently perform well in a wide range of climates and are excellent choices for both novice and experienced gardeners.

The Classic 'California Wonder'

We consider the 'California Wonder' to be a cornerstone of the bell pepper world. It is a timetested heirloom variety that has been a favorite for generations, and for good reason. From our experience, these plants are remarkably productive, yielding a generous amount of large, blocky, fourlobed peppers. The fruits are known for their thick walls and sweet, mild flavor, making them incredibly versatile in the kitchen. We have found that 'California Wonder' plants are also quite resilient and adapt well to various growing conditions, which is why we often recommend them to firsttime gardeners.

The HighYielding 'Jupiter'

For those seeking a truly prolific harvest, we suggest the 'Jupiter' bell pepper. This hybrid variety is engineered for high performance. We have seen these plants produce an astonishing number of large, bellshaped fruits that ripen from a deep green to a brilliant red. What sets 'Jupiter' apart is its vigorous growth and strong, upright habit, which helps to support the heavy fruit load. We have found that the peppers from this plant have an excellent flavor and are perfect for a variety of culinary applications, from salads to stirfries.

We highly recommend 'King Arthur' for gardeners who are looking for a compact plant that still delivers a significant yield. This variety is known for its relatively short stature, which makes it an excellent choice for container gardening or for smaller garden plots. Despite its size, 'King Arthur' produces a large number of impressive, thickwalled peppers. We have observed that the fruit sets earlier than many other varieties, allowing for a quicker harvest. The peppers themselves are known for their crisp texture and delicious, sweet taste.

The Reliable 'Emerald Giant'

We have found that the 'Emerald Giant' lives up to its name, producing truly gigantic green bell peppers. From our handson experience, this openpollinated variety is a consistent producer of large, blocky fruits with a satisfyingly sweet and mild flavor. The plants are robust and sturdy, capable of supporting the weight of their massive peppers. We consider this variety to be a staple for anyone who wants a dependable and bountiful harvest of classic green bell peppers.

Sunlight: The Power Source for Your Peppers

We find that bell pepper plants are sunworshippers. They require a minimum of 6 to 8 hours of direct sunlight each day to produce a significant yield. We have observed that plants grown in partial shade often become leggy and produce fewer, smaller fruits. For gardeners in extremely hot climates, we recommend providing some afternoon shade during the hottest parts of the day to prevent the plants from becoming stressed and to avoid sunscald on the developing peppers. This is a crucial detail that we have found can make a tremendous difference in both the quality and quantity of your harvest.

Soil Preparation: Building the Foundation for Success

We know that the quality of your soil is the single most important factor in a plant's health. We advocate for a soil that is rich in organic matter, loamy, and welldraining. Bell peppers prefer a slightly acidic to neutral soil pH, typically in the range of 6.0 to 6.8. We recommend amending your garden beds with generous amounts of compost or wellrotted manure before planting. This not only improves soil structure and drainage but also provides a slowrelease source of essential nutrients. We advise against using heavy clay soils, as they can retain too much moisture and lead to root rot.

Watering: The Art of Balance

We believe that proper watering is an art form, especially with bell pepper plants. They require consistent moisture, but they absolutely despise soggy feet. We recommend a deep watering of 1 to 2 inches per week, with more frequent watering during periods of extreme heat or drought. The key is to water at the base of the plant to avoid getting the foliage wet, which can lead to fungal diseases. We have found that using a soaker hose or drip irrigation system is an excellent way to ensure consistent, deep watering while minimizing water waste and the risk of disease. We strongly advise against a schedule of light, daily watering, as this encourages shallow root growth and makes the plants more susceptible to drought stress.

Fertilizing for a Bountiful Harvest

We find that bell pepper plants are heavy feeders, especially during the fruiting stage. We recommend a balanced fertilizer at the time of planting, followed by a lownitrogen, highphosphorus and potassium fertilizer once the plants begin to flower and set fruit. A common NPK ratio we recommend is 51010 or something similar. We have observed that too much nitrogen will promote lush, leafy growth at the expense of fruit production. We prefer using organic fertilizers like bone meal for phosphorus and kelp meal for potassium. We suggest a sidedressing application every 4 to 6 weeks to ensure a continuous supply of nutrients.

Staking: Providing the Right Support

We believe that staking is an oftenoverlooked but vital step, particularly for highyield varieties. The weight of a mature bell pepper plant laden with fruit can cause the stems to bend or break. We recommend installing stakes or cages at the time of planting to avoid damaging the root system later on. A simple bamboo stake or a tomato cage works wonderfully. We advise that you gently tie the main stem to the stake with a soft material, like a garden tie or old tshirt strips, allowing for some movement and growth without causing constriction. This simple act can prevent significant crop loss and ensure your peppers stay off the ground and away from pests and rot.

Common Pests and Diseases: Proactive Prevention and Treatment

We are well aware that even the most meticulously caredfor bell pepper plants can fall victim to pests and diseases. We believe that the best approach is always a proactive one, but we are also prepared to provide you with effective, organic solutions for common problems. We have identified some of the most frequent threats to green bell pepper plants and will now outline our recommended strategies for dealing with them.

Battling the Aphid Invasion

From our experience, aphids are one of the most common and persistent pests for bell pepper plants. These small, softbodied insects cluster on the underside of leaves and new growth, sucking the sap and causing the leaves to curl and distort. We recommend a twopronged approach. First, we encourage a strong spray of water from a hose to physically dislodge them. Second, for more severe infestations, we advise using an organic insecticidal soap or neem oil spray. We have found that consistent application every 7 to 10 days is key to breaking their life cycle. We also recommend introducing beneficial insects like ladybugs, which are voracious predators of aphids.

Dealing with Fungal Diseases

We have found that fungal diseases, such as powdery mildew and bacterial leaf spot, are often caused by poor air circulation and excessive moisture on the leaves. We strongly recommend that you practice proper watering techniques, avoiding overhead irrigation. We also advise that you space your plants adequately to ensure good air flow. For prevention, we suggest a weekly application of a fungicidal spray like a diluted baking soda solution or a commercial copper fungicide. For bacterial leaf spot, we have observed that removing and destroying affected leaves is crucial to prevent the spread of the disease.

Harvesting Your Green Bell Peppers at the Perfect Time

The final and most rewarding step is the harvest. We believe that knowing exactly when to pick your peppers is the difference between a good pepper and a truly exceptional one. We will now provide our expert guidance on the timing and technique for harvesting your green bell peppers.

Signs of Ripeness: When to Pick

We recommend harvesting green bell peppers when they have reached their full size and have a firm, glossy appearance. The skin should be taut and the color a deep, vibrant green. We suggest waiting an additional one to two weeks after they have reached full size to allow the walls to thicken and the flavor to develop fully. We advise against picking peppers that are still small or feel soft, as they will be bitter and lack the desired crunch. We also believe that continuous harvesting encourages the plant to produce more fruit, so we recommend picking your peppers as soon as they are ready.

The Right Technique for a Clean Harvest

We stress the importance of using a clean, sharp tool for harvesting. We have found that using a pair of shears or gardening scissors to snip the stem a couple of inches above the pepper is the best method. We advise against pulling or yanking the peppers from the plant, as this can damage the stem and even break the entire branch, harming future yields. A clean cut ensures that the plant remains healthy and ready to produce more fruit for you to enjoy.
